Half-Time Report: Fulham trailing at home to Preston North End thanks to Joe Garner header

Joe Garner scores the only goal of the first half as Preston North End lead at Fulham.

Preston North End have carved out a 1-0 lead at managerless Fulham thanks to an early header from Joe Garner.

The visitors almost drew first blood following a lively opening when Eoin Doyle let fly from distance with a powerful drive that Joe Lewis could only parry.

That early warning went unheeded and Fulham found themselves behind in the 10th minute as an unmarked Garner headed in at the back post.

Ross McCormack proved a handful for the Preston defence in the first half, but Fulham struggled to provide him with decent service as Preston threw bodies back to thwart their advance.

The hosts came closest to an equaliser on the half-hour mark when Moussa Dembele pulled the trigger from just outside the box, but his curling effort was met by a finger-tip save from Jason Pickford.

However, Preston should have taken as two goal lead into the break as Doyle missed the target with a close-range header just minutes before the referee's whistle.
